博客 指标溯源分析的技术实现与优化方法

指标溯源分析的技术实现与优化方法

   数栈君   发表于 2026-02-26 17:46  43  0

在数字化转型的浪潮中,企业越来越依赖数据驱动决策。然而,数据孤岛、数据质量不一致以及数据来源不明确等问题,常常导致企业在数据分析和决策过程中面临诸多挑战。指标溯源分析作为一种重要的数据分析方法,能够帮助企业从复杂的业务指标中追根溯源,找到数据背后的真实含义和问题所在。本文将深入探讨指标溯源分析的技术实现与优化方法,为企业提供实用的指导。


什么是指标溯源分析?

指标溯源分析是一种通过对业务指标的层层剖析,追查其数据来源、处理过程和影响因素的方法。其核心目标是帮助企业在复杂的数据生态系统中,快速定位问题、优化数据流程并提升数据质量。

例如,当企业发现某个关键业务指标(如销售额)出现异常时,可以通过指标溯源分析,确定异常数据的具体来源、数据处理环节以及可能的影响因素。这种方法不仅能够帮助企业快速解决问题,还能为未来的数据治理和优化提供重要参考。


指标溯源分析的技术实现

指标溯源分析的技术实现涉及多个环节,包括数据建模、数据血缘分析、数据质量管理、数据可视化以及日志分析与跟踪。以下将详细介绍这些技术的实现方法。

1. 数据建模与标准化

数据建模是指标溯源分析的基础。通过构建统一的数据模型,企业可以将分散在不同系统中的数据进行标准化处理,确保数据的唯一性和准确性。

  • 数据实体化:将业务中的实体(如客户、订单、产品等)映射到数据模型中,确保数据的语义一致性。
  • 数据标准化:对数据进行统一的格式化处理,例如将日期格式统一为YYYY-MM-DD,将数值类型统一为DECIMAL
  • 数据关联化:通过建立数据之间的关联关系(如订单与客户的关系),为指标溯源提供数据依赖性支持。

2. 数据血缘分析

数据血缘分析是指标溯源分析的核心技术之一。它通过记录数据的来源、处理流程和使用场景,帮助企业清晰了解数据的流动路径。

  • 数据血缘建模:通过ETL(Extract, Transform, Load)工具或数据集成平台,记录数据从源系统到目标系统的流动路径。
  • 数据血缘可视化:利用数据可视化工具(如Tableau、Power BI)将数据血缘关系以图形化的方式展示,便于用户理解。
  • 数据血缘追踪:当某个指标出现异常时,通过数据血缘关系快速定位到具体的数据来源或处理环节。

3. 数据质量管理

数据质量是指标溯源分析的重要保障。只有确保数据的准确性、完整性和一致性,才能为指标分析提供可靠的基础。

  • 数据清洗:通过数据清洗工具(如Apache Nifi、Informatica)对数据进行去重、补全和格式化处理。
  • 数据标准化:统一数据格式和命名规则,避免因数据格式不一致导致的分析误差。
  • 数据验证:通过数据验证规则(如正则表达式、数据校验码)确保数据的准确性。

4. 数据可视化与交互

数据可视化是指标溯源分析的重要表现形式。通过直观的可视化界面,用户可以快速理解数据的流动路径和问题所在。

  • 数据仪表盘:构建数据仪表盘,将关键业务指标和数据血缘关系以图表形式展示。
  • 交互式分析:支持用户通过交互式操作(如点击、筛选、钻取)深入探索数据。
  • 动态更新:确保数据仪表盘能够实时更新,反映最新的数据变化。

5. 日志分析与跟踪

日志分析是指标溯源分析的重要补充。通过对系统日志的分析,可以进一步确认数据处理过程中的问题。

  • 日志采集:通过日志采集工具(如ELK Stack、Flume)收集系统运行日志。
  • 日志解析:对日志进行解析和结构化处理,提取有用的信息(如错误代码、时间戳)。
  • 日志关联:将日志与数据血缘关系相结合,进一步确认数据处理过程中的问题。

指标溯源分析的优化方法

为了进一步提升指标溯源分析的效果,企业可以采取以下优化方法。

1. 数据治理与标准化

数据治理是指标溯源分析的基础保障。通过建立完善的数据治理体系,企业可以确保数据的准确性和一致性。

  • 数据目录:建立数据目录,记录企业中所有数据资产的元数据信息。
  • 数据地图:构建数据地图,展示企业数据的分布和使用情况。
  • 数据生命周期管理:从数据生成、存储、使用到归档,全程管理数据,确保数据的合规性和可用性。

2. 技术优化

技术优化是提升指标溯源分析效率的重要手段。通过引入先进的技术工具,企业可以显著提升分析效率。

  • 分布式计算框架:利用Hadoop、Spark等分布式计算框架,提升大规模数据处理的效率。
  • 流处理技术:通过Flink、Storm等流处理框架,实现实时数据处理和分析。
  • 机器学习:引入机器学习算法,对数据进行预测和异常检测,辅助指标分析。

3. 用户反馈与持续优化

用户反馈是优化指标溯源分析的重要依据。通过收集用户的使用反馈,企业可以不断改进分析方法和工具。

  • 用户调研:定期开展用户调研,了解用户在使用指标溯源分析工具中的痛点和需求。
  • 功能迭代:根据用户反馈,持续优化工具的功能和性能。
  • 培训与支持:为用户提供全面的培训和支持,确保用户能够熟练使用工具。

4. 自动化工具

自动化工具是提升指标溯源分析效率的重要手段。通过引入自动化工具,企业可以显著减少人工干预,提升分析效率。

  • 自动化数据清洗:通过自动化工具(如Apache Nifi)实现数据清洗和转换的自动化。
  • 自动化报告生成:通过自动化工具生成分析报告,减少人工操作。
  • 自动化监控:通过自动化监控工具(如Prometheus、Grafana)实现数据的实时监控和异常报警。

指标溯源分析的应用场景

指标溯源分析在企业中的应用场景非常广泛,以下是几个典型的场景。

1. 数据中台建设

在数据中台建设中,指标溯源分析可以帮助企业实现数据的统一管理和共享。

  • 数据血缘分析:通过数据血缘分析,帮助企业理清数据的来源和流向。
  • 数据质量管理:通过数据质量管理,确保数据的准确性和一致性。
  • 数据可视化:通过数据可视化,为企业提供直观的数据分析界面。

2. 数字孪生

在数字孪生中,指标溯源分析可以帮助企业实现对物理世界的实时监控和优化。

  • 实时数据监控:通过数字孪生平台,实时监控物理设备的运行状态。
  • 数据关联分析:通过数据关联分析,找出影响设备运行的关键因素。
  • 预测性维护:通过机器学习算法,预测设备的故障风险,实现预测性维护。

3. 数字可视化

在数字可视化中,指标溯源分析可以帮助企业实现对业务的全面洞察。

  • 数据仪表盘:通过数据仪表盘,展示企业的关键业务指标和数据趋势。
  • 交互式分析:通过交互式分析,用户可以深入探索数据的细节。
  • 动态更新:通过动态更新,确保数据仪表盘能够实时反映最新的数据变化。

指标溯源分析的挑战与解决方案

尽管指标溯源分析具有诸多优势,但在实际应用中仍面临一些挑战。

1. 数据复杂性

随着企业规模的扩大,数据来源和类型越来越多,导致数据复杂性增加。

  • 解决方案:通过数据治理和标准化,提升数据的可管理性和可追溯性。

2. 技术限制

现有的技术工具在处理大规模数据时,往往面临性能瓶颈。

  • 解决方案:通过分布式计算和流处理技术,提升数据处理的效率。

3. 用户需求多样性

不同用户对指标溯源分析的需求存在差异,导致工具的通用性不足。

  • 解决方案:通过定制化开发和用户培训,满足不同用户的需求。

结语

指标溯源分析作为一种重要的数据分析方法,能够帮助企业从复杂的业务指标中追根溯源,找到数据背后的真实含义和问题所在。通过数据建模、数据血缘分析、数据质量管理、数据可视化以及日志分析与跟踪等技术手段,企业可以显著提升指标溯源分析的效率和效果。同时,通过数据治理、技术优化、用户反馈和自动化工具等优化方法,企业可以进一步提升指标溯源分析的能力。

如果您对指标溯源分析感兴趣,或者希望申请试用相关工具,可以访问我们的网站了解更多详情:申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料